Transaction fa2451ecda26760927a87596d5ddf70cd2b78895a9adf0636d797f208c504a5c

62 Input
2 Outputs
  • fa2451ecda26760927a87596d5ddf70cd2b78895a9adf0636d797f208c504a5c:0
  • value  1019391
    address  3CPkJGUhosiHyegbYXfHgCmvtrsknUHtGk
  • fa2451ecda26760927a87596d5ddf70cd2b78895a9adf0636d797f208c504a5c:1
  • value  484571776
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s